About the neighborhood
San Marcos
Located on a river, this vacation home is in Rio Vista, a neighborhood in San Marcos. Charles S. Cock House Museum and Calaboose African American History Museum are cultural highlights, and some of the area's attractions include San Marcos Discovery Center and Meadows Center for Water and the Environment. Wonder World Cave & Adventure Park and Young County Arena are also worth visiting. Discover the area's water adventures with kayaking and swimming nearby, or enjoy the great outdoors with hiking and ecotours.
